Common Misconceptions About Unit Converters
One common misconception is that all unit conversions involve simple multiplication. While many do, especially within the same dimension (e.g., meters to feet), others like temperature conversions (Celsius to Fahrenheit) involve more complex formulas with addition/subtraction before multiplication. Another misconception is that a converter can handle any unit imaginable; while comprehensive, specialized units (e.g., specific gravity, light years) might require more advanced tools. General Purpose Unit Converter Formula and Mathematical Explanation
The core principle behind a General Purpose Unit Converter is the application of conversion factors or specific mathematical formulas. For most linear conversions (like length, weight, volume, time), the process involves a direct multiplication or division by a constant factor. For example, to convert meters to feet, you multiply the number of meters by 3.28084.
Step-by-Step Derivation:
- Identify the Input: You start with a numerical value and its original unit (e.g., 10 meters).
- Identify the Target: You specify the desired output unit (e.g., feet).
- Find the Conversion Factor: The calculator looks up the specific factor that relates the input unit to the output unit. If a direct factor isn’t available, it might convert to a base unit first (e.g., meters to feet, or grams to kilograms then to pounds).
- Apply the Formula:
- For linear conversions: `Output Value = Input Value × Conversion Factor`
- For non-linear conversions (e.g., Temperature): Specific formulas are used.
- Celsius to Fahrenheit: `F = (C × 9/5) + 32`
- Fahrenheit to Celsius: `C = (F – 32) × 5/9`
- Display Result: The calculated output value is presented with the target unit.

Practical Examples (Real-World Use Cases)
Example 1: Converting Recipe Ingredients
A chef finds a delicious recipe online, but all the measurements are in metric units, and their kitchen uses imperial. They need to convert 250 grams of flour to ounces and 1.5 liters of milk to cups.
- Input for Flour: Value = 250, Input Unit = Grams, Output Unit = Ounces (Weight)
- Calculation: 250 grams × 0.035274 oz/gram = 8.8185 ounces
- Input for Milk: Value = 1.5, Input Unit = Liters, Output Unit = Cups (Volume)
- Calculation: 1.5 liters × 4.22675 cups/liter = 6.340125 cups
Using the General Purpose Unit Converter, the chef quickly gets 8.82 ounces of flour and approximately 6.34 cups of milk, ensuring the recipe turns out perfectly.
Example 2: Understanding International Weather Reports
A traveler from the United States is planning a trip to Europe and sees a weather forecast predicting a high of 28°C. They need to convert this to Fahrenheit to understand what to pack.
- Input: Value = 28, Input Unit = Celsius, Output Unit = Fahrenheit (Temperature)
- Calculation: (28 × 9/5) + 32 = (50.4) + 32 = 82.4°F
With the General Purpose Unit Converter, the traveler knows that 28°C is equivalent to 82.4°F, indicating warm weather suitable for light clothing. This General Purpose Unit Converter makes travel planning much easier.

Key Factors That Affect General Purpose Unit Converter Results
While a General Purpose Unit Converter primarily relies on fixed mathematical relationships, several factors can influence the *perception* or *application* of its results, especially in real-world scenarios:
- Precision of Input Value: The accuracy of your input value directly impacts the accuracy of the output. Entering “1.5” versus “1.500” can affect the precision of the final converted number, especially when dealing with significant figures.
- Rounding Rules: Different contexts (e.g., scientific, engineering, culinary) may require different rounding rules. Our General Purpose Unit Converter provides a precise result, but you might need to round it for practical application.
- Unit System Consistency: Ensuring you consistently use either metric or imperial units within a project or calculation is crucial. Mixing them without proper conversion is a common source of error.
- Context of Measurement: Some units have different meanings depending on context (e.g., “cup” can vary slightly in volume between countries). While our General Purpose Unit Converter uses standard definitions, be aware of regional variations.
- Conversion Factor Accuracy: The underlying conversion factors used by any General Purpose Unit Converter are typically highly accurate, but they are often derived from international standards. Minor discrepancies can arise if using slightly different definitions or older standards.
- Type of Conversion (Linear vs. Non-linear): As discussed, linear conversions are straightforward multiplication. Non-linear conversions, like temperature, involve more complex formulas, which can sometimes be misunderstood if one expects a simple ratio.
- Data Entry Errors: The most common factor affecting results is simply human error in entering the initial value or selecting the wrong units. Always double-check your inputs when using any General Purpose Unit Converter.

Q: Why do some conversions use a formula instead of a simple factor?
A: Conversions like temperature (Celsius to Fahrenheit) are non-linear. This means their relationship isn’t a simple ratio but involves an offset (addition/subtraction) in addition to scaling (multiplication/division). Our General Purpose Unit Converter accounts for these specific formulas.
Q: How do I know which unit to select if there are multiple options (e.g., “cup”)?
A: Our General Purpose Unit Converter uses standard definitions for units. For “cup,” it typically refers to the US customary cup. If you’re working with specific regional variations (e.g., UK cup), you might need to verify the exact conversion factor for that specific context.
